Sirens Soar to Dominant 4-1 Victory Over Pietà Hotspurs

Sirens showcased their attacking prowess with a commanding 4-1 victory over Pietà Hotspurs, solidifying their position in the Challenge League. This match marked a significant turnaround for Sirens, who had been inconsistent in recent weeks, but their offensive firepower shone brightly today. With this win, they now sit comfortably in 6th place, having accumulated 17 points from 10 matches.

Sirens have found their rhythm lately, scoring 10 goals in their last three matches. The standout performers have been Nonato and Akadom, both of whom have consistently found the back of the net. Nonato's contributions have been particularly crucial, as he scored in the previous match against Mgarr United and continued his scoring streak today. Akadom, who also netted twice in the recent 4-0 victory against St. Andrews, has emerged as a key figure in Sirens' resurgence.

Defensively, Sirens still have room for improvement despite today's win. They conceded a goal to Pietà, which highlights ongoing vulnerabilities at the back. The team has allowed eight goals in their last five matches, raising questions about their ability to maintain clean sheets against tougher opponents. However, the offensive output today may provide the confidence needed to address these defensive lapses moving forward.

Pietà Hotspurs entered this match with a mixed bag of results, having recently secured a resounding 5-0 victory against Mtarfa in the FA Trophy. However, that momentum did not carry over into this league fixture. Despite showing flashes of potential, they struggled to convert chances into goals and ultimately fell victim to Sirens' relentless attack. The loss leaves them languishing in 10th place with only 14 points from 10 matches.

The absence of key players for Pietà was felt acutely today. Their inability to capitalize on scoring opportunities was evident, particularly after they managed to find the net just before halftime. The red card issued in the 72nd minute further compounded their woes, leaving them with a numerical disadvantage that Sirens exploited ruthlessly. This defeat underscores the challenges Pietà faces as they attempt to climb out of the relegation zone.

Bio, who had been instrumental in Pietà's recent successes, struggled to make an impact today. After scoring in their last league match against Swieqi United, he was unable to replicate that form against a resolute Sirens defense. The pressure is mounting on Pietà to find consistency and build on their earlier successes if they hope to avoid slipping further down the table.

Looking ahead, Sirens will face Gudja United next week, where they will aim to build on this momentum and solidify their mid-table standing. Meanwhile, Pietà will host Fgura United, desperately seeking points to escape the relegation battle that looms large. Both teams have pivotal matches ahead that could shape their seasons.
